OAKLAND — Cameron Glover scored three goals and dished out an assist, and Alex Croatti, Bailey Caparratto and Chris Snyder each had two goals as the Brunswick High School boys lacrosse team rolled to a 13-3 victory over Messalonskee in Eastern Maine Class A action on Wednesday.
Brunswick, 2-0 and slated to host rival Mt. Ararat (1-0) on Friday at 6:30 p.m., jumped on top 3-0, led 5-2 at the half and 8-2 after three quarters.
Mitchell Cooney added a goal and two assists for the Dragons, with Seth Holmblad and Winston Sullivan chipping in a goal and one helper apiece. Charlie Nau also scored a goal, with Croatti adding an assist to his totals.
In goal, Brunswick netminders James Wilgus and Chris Mrvichin combined on 12 stops, while Sam Fortin won 68 percent of his faceoffs.
Aidan Culkias paced 0- 2 Messalonskee with two goals, with Luke Vigue chipping in a goal.
